Asian Games: India bags silver in athletics, two bronze in tennis

India has started on winning ways the Incheon Asian Games. A Silver in Athletics, and two Bronze in Tennis have came so far today, but road have been mapped for gold medals.Grapplers have started their mark, after bagging two bronze yesterday, Yogeshwar Dutt lived upto his reputation entering finals of men's 65 kg freestyle. In semi final olympian Yogeshwar came from two point deficit and a minute left to pin his opponent.Expecting on his continued performance we hope that he bags the yellow metal today. Other grapplers like Babita Kumari and Satywart Kadian are figuring in repechage round, hunting for bronze. Earlier, Athletics brought first medal of the day in silver form as Khushbir Kaur finished second in the Women's 20km Race Walk. Bronze came from tennis court today.Yuki Bhambri bagged bronze in Men's singles event. The pair of Sania Mirza and Prarthana Thombare also settled for a bronze in women's doubles semi final. Sania will also be seen in action in the Mixed Doubles semi-finals with Saketh Myneni. Indian duo of Sanam Singh and Saketh Myneni have luminated hope for gold as they entered men's doubles final. We can also witness an all Indian finals if another Indian duo of Yuki Bhambri and Divij Sharan defeat Korea in semi finals. Pugilists have surged ahead in semis, MC Mary Kom, Laishram Sarita Devi and Pooja Rani all adavnced to semis. Kabaddi, saw India dominating Bangladesh in the preliminary round in both Men's and Women's section.
